Why Choosing the Right Glass Thickness is a Life-or-Death (For Your Floor) Decision


Most people think the sum volume of the tank dictates the glass thickness. They think a 100-gallon tank needs thicker glass than a 50-gallon tank just because it holds more water. That is a myth. The real killer of glass is height. Water pressure increases next depth. A tank that is four feet long but forlorn 12 inches high puts much less play up upon the panels than a tank that is two feet high. This is why a fish tank glass size calculator focuses heavily on the vertical dimension.

Using a Fish Tank Glass Size Calculator to Avoid the "Wet Basement" Syndrome


When you plug your dimensions into a custom aquarium glass calculator, you are looking for the Safety Factor. In the glass world, a Safety Factor (S.F.) of 3.8 is the industry gold standard. everything lower than a 2.5 is basically a ticking time bomb. A 2.0 S.F. means the glass is at its perfect limit. If your cat jumps upon top of the tank or you accidentally collision it as soon as a vacuum cleanerpop.


To use a Fish Tank Glass Size Calculator: The Right Glass Size For Your DIY Aquarium, you compulsion three primary inputs: length, width, and height. But heres a tip most guides miss: calculate your glass thickness based on the water level, not the total height of the glass. If you have a 24-inch tall tank but abandoned fill it to 22 inches, your pressure load changes. However, for maximum safety, always calculate for a "full-to-the-brim" upset scenario.


I always suggest people use the aquarium glass weight calculator to see if their floor can even handle the over and done with product. Glass is heavy. Thick glass is exponentially heavier. A 12mm glass aquarium weighs a ton before you even increase a single fall of water.

Annealed vs. Tempered: Which Glass Wins the Heavyweight Title?


This is where things acquire controversial in the hobbyist world. Annealed glass is your okay plate glass. Its what most of us use. You can cut it yourself, you can sand the edges, and its forgiving. Tempered glass is four to five epoch stronger, but you cannot clip it afterward its been treated.


If you use a Fish Tank Glass Size Calculator for tempered glass, you might think you can acquire away behind incredibly thin panes. Technically, you can. But theres a catch. Tempered glass is totally vulnerable at the edges. One little chip from a rock or a fragment of driftwood can cause the entire pane to shatter instantly. I personally prefer low-iron annealed glass (often called Starphire) for my builds. It gives you that crystal-clear high-definition view without the "exploding" risk of tempered glass.


When you are calculating aquarium glass thickness, always ask your supplier if the glass is "float glass." advocate float glass is incredibly uniform. Safety Factor (S.F.) Explained: Why 3.8 is the magic Number


Lets talk numbers. Why 3.8? Why not 3.0? Glass is an unpredictable material. Unlike steel, which fails in a predictable way, glass has "surface fatigue." more than years of holding help water, little scratches (from cleaning magnets or sand) can weaken the structure. A Fish Tank Glass Size Calculator: The Right Glass Size For Your DIY Aquarium that uses a 3.8 Safety Factor accounts for these cutting edge scratches. It accounts for the era you accidentally hit the glass taking into consideration a close fragment of Seiryu stone though aquascaping.


If you are building a DIY plywood aquarium past a glass front, the rules change. before isolated one side is glass, you can sometimes go slightly thinner because you have a rigid frame on three sides. But for a full-glass aquarium, the corners are your highest emphasize points. The right glass size for a 100-gallon tank might be 12mm for the sides but 15mm for the bottom. Always make the bottom pane at least as thick as the sidespreferably thicker if you scheme upon stacking stifling rocks.
